Oostertocht Zuid, Dijk en Waard
NeighbourhoodThis detached house on Kreillaan sits in a leafy part of Oostertocht Zuid, with a large garden and a sunny orientation. Built in 1997 and with an A energy label, it offers 130 m² of living space on a 260 m² plot. The asking price of €649,000 is 23% above the neighbourhood average of €526,625, which reflects the size and quality of this home compared to other detached houses in Dijk en Waard.
Oostertocht Zuid is a residential area built mainly between 1990 and 2010, so the streets are spacious and the homes are modern. Most properties are owner-occupied (76%) and the neighbourhood has a strong family feel, with many households with children. The park is just a couple of streets away, and the area scores low on crime. There are no resident reviews available for this neighbourhood, but the CBS figures show a mix of ages and a high proportion of families. This is a quiet, well-maintained part of the Oostertocht Zuid neighbourhood.
For your morning bread, Albert Heijn is just around the corner, and Aldi and Vomar are a five-minute walk. Primary schools are also close: Openbare Basisschool De Hasselbraam and Kinddomein de Zeppelin are both on your doorstep, and Familieschool is a couple of streets away. The train station is 3.3 km away, so you'll need a bike or car for the commute. The municipality of the municipality of Dijk en Waard covers a wide area, but here in Oostertocht you have everything you need within walking distance.

About Kreillaan 89, Heerhugowaard
The asking price is 23% above the average asking price in Oostertocht Zuid, which is €526,625. However, this home is larger than many in the neighbourhood (130 m² vs an average of 124 m²) and has an A energy label. The price reflects its size, plot, and modern build year. Whether it is fair depends on how you value those extras compared to other homes for sale in the area.
Oostertocht Zuid is very family-oriented: 79% of homes are single-family houses, and many households have children. The streets are quiet, there is a park nearby, and primary schools are within walking distance. The area was built between 1990 and 2010, so the housing stock is modern and well-maintained.
Albert Heijn is 516 metres away, just around the corner. Aldi is 726 metres and Vomar is 841 metres, both a five-minute walk. For daily groceries you have several options within easy reach.
Openbare Basisschool De Hasselbraam and Kinddomein de Zeppelin are both about 550 metres away, on your doorstep. Familieschool is 837 metres, a couple of streets away. There are also several other primary schools within a kilometre, so you have plenty of choice.
The home has an A energy label, which is very efficient. In the neighbourhood, 66.7% of homes have label A and none have label D or lower, so this is in line with the local standard. You can expect relatively low heating costs.
The nearest train station is 3.3 km away. That is about a 10-minute bike ride or a short drive.
